Roles in this chart include Green IT Strategist, Green IT Analyst, Green IT Architect, Green IT Engineer, and Green IT Consultant. The Green IT Strategist role leads the development and execution of the organization's Green IT strategy, aimed at reducing the environmental impact of IT operations while maximizing efficiency. Green IT Analysts focus on monitoring and analyzing the organization's IT infrastructure and systems to identify potential areas for improvement and cost reduction. The Green IT Architect role is responsible for designing and implementing sustainable IT infrastructure and systems, ensuring that the organization's technology stack is both environmentally friendly and efficient. Green IT Engineers focus on building and maintaining sustainable IT systems and infrastructure, working closely with Green IT Architects to ensure that the organization's technology stack is optimized for performance and energy efficiency. Finally, Green IT Consultants provide expert advice and guidance to organizations seeking to improve their IT sustainability and reduce their environmental impact. These professionals help organizations identify areas for improvement, develop and implement Green IT strategies, and optimize their IT infrastructure for sustainability and efficiency.
